In 2026, the restaurant industry is more competitive than ever, and for an Indian restaurant, the challenge lies in standing out among a sea of dining options. So, here are some top strategies to ensure your restaurant stays top-of-mind for every hungry diner in your area.

Partner with local influencers

Word-of-mouth has moved from the backyard fence to the smartphone screen. So, you should invite local food bloggers and influencers to your restaurant for a dedicated review session. This is one of the fastest ways to build social proof. Instead of a traditional ad, an influencer’s Reel showing the steam rising off a fresh plate of lamb rogan josh feels like a recommendation from a friend. These partnerships allow you to tap into an established audience that already trusts the creator’s palate. To make the most of this, offer influencers a unique experience, such as a chef’s table preview of a new seasonal menu. 

Build a user-friendly website

Your website is your digital storefront, and it should be as inviting as your physical dining room. In an era where diners expect instant information, your site must be optimized for speed and mobile use. Ensure that your menu is easy to navigate, with clear descriptions of spice levels and dietary labels like vegan or gluten-free. An integrated reservation system and a prominent ‘Order Online’ button are non-negotiable features for 2026. If you provide a frictionless experience, you turn casual browsers into confirmed guests.

Master the art of local SEO

Most dining decisions start with a search for ‘best Indian food near me’. To win this search, you must prioritize local SEO. This starts with a fully optimized Google Business Profile, complete with high-resolution photos of your interior and signature dishes. Encourage satisfied guests to leave reviews, and make it a point to respond to them promptly. In addition, Google’s current algorithms heavily favor review velocity, i.e, the frequency of new reviews. They also focus on accurate, consistent business information across all directories. When your SEO is sharp, your restaurant becomes the first choice for local diners.

Decoding the Ingredient List

The most reliable indicator of quality is found on the back of the wrapper. High-quality chocolate is defined by its simplicity. For a standard dark chocolate bar, you should ideally see only a few components: cacao beans, cocoa butter, and sugar. Some makers may add a touch of vanilla or an emulsifier like sunflower or soy lecithin to improve texture, but these should be at the bottom of the list. If you see vegetable oils, vanillin—the synthetic version of vanilla—or an abundance of corn syrup, you are likely looking at a lower-quality product designed for shelf stability rather than flavor.

Cocoa butter is perhaps the most critical ingredient to verify. Because cocoa butter is a valuable commodity used in the cosmetics industry, many mass-market manufacturers strip it out of their chocolate and replace it with cheaper fats like palm oil or shea butter. This substitution is why some chocolate feels waxy or fails to melt smoothly on the tongue. Real chocolate relies on the unique melting point of cocoa butter, which is just below human body temperature. This is what creates that luxurious, silky sensation as the chocolate dissipates in your mouth.

Understanding Percentage and Origin

The percentage listed on a chocolate bar refers to the total amount of the product that comes from the cacao bean, including both the cocoa solids and the cocoa butter. A higher percentage typically indicates a less sweet, more intense flavor profile. However, percentage alone is not a guarantee of quality. A seventy percent bar made from poorly fermented or over-roasted beans will taste bitter and burnt, while a bar of the same percentage made from premium heirloom cacao can reveal notes of red fruit, jasmine, or toasted nuts.

This leads to the importance of origin. Just as soil and climate affect the taste of grapes in winemaking, the terroir of a cacao-growing region shapes the chocolate’s personality. Single-origin chocolate is sourced from a specific country or even a single estate, allowing the unique characteristics of that region to shine. For instance, cacao from Madagascar is often prized for its bright, citrusy acidity, while beans from Ecuador may lean toward earthy and floral profiles. Blended chocolates can be delicious, but single-origin bars offer a focused tasting experience that helps you identify which regions your palate prefers.

Building Your Personal Palate

The best way to become an expert at choosing chocolate is to conduct your own side-by-side tastings. Buy two or three dark bars with the same cocoa percentage but from different origins or makers. Pay attention to how the textures differ and which flavor notes stand out to you. Over time, you will find that your preferences change and your ability to detect subtle nuances improves.

I have watched thousands of guests approach their first omakase meal with the same look on their face. Curiosity mixed with a little nervous excitement. Some people whisper the word like it is a secret. Others ask if it is expensive, or if they are supposed to dress differently, or if they will even like everything they are served.

Omakase does not need to feel intimidating. At its core, it is simply a conversation between you and the chef, told through food.

The word “omakase” roughly translates to “I leave it up to you.” That is the spirit of the experience. You are not ordering off a menu. You are placing your trust in the chef’s hands and allowing them to guide your meal.

What Omakase Really Means

Omakase is not about showing off rare ingredients or creating a performance. It is about seasonality, balance, and craftsmanship. Each course is chosen based on what is freshest that day, what flavors will build on each other, and how the meal should progress.

You might start with something light and delicate, then move into richer flavors, followed by a refreshing reset, and finish with something comforting. The pacing matters. The order matters. The story matters.

Every omakase is different because every day’s ingredients are different.

How to Prepare for Your First Omakase

The best thing you can bring is an open mind. Leave expectations at the door. You do not need to research every fish or technique beforehand. Trust that the chef has spent years learning how to craft this experience for you.

It also helps to avoid eating too much beforehand. Omakase is meant to be enjoyed fully, from the first bite to the last.

If you have allergies or strong dislikes, speak up at the beginning. This is not considered rude. It is helpful.

How to Sit and Observe

If you are seated at the counter, you are in the best seat in the house. Watch the hands. Watch the timing. Watch how each piece is prepared only moments before it reaches you.

This is not fast food. It is not meant to be rushed. When a piece is placed in front of you, enjoy it while it is at its peak. Temperature and texture change quickly. Omakase rewards attention.

How to Eat the Courses

Many omakase courses are designed to be eaten in one bite. This is not about being fancy. It is about experiencing the full balance of flavors exactly as the chef intended.

Try not to drown each piece in extra sauce unless suggested. Most of the seasoning has already been carefully planned.

If you are unsure how to eat something, simply watch. The rhythm of the room usually guides you.

How to Interact With the Chef

You do not need to perform. You do not need special knowledge. A simple thank you and genuine appreciation go a long way.

If something surprises you, say so. If you love something, say so. Chefs appreciate real reactions.

Silence is also acceptable. Sometimes the best compliment is focused eating.

Pacing and Drinking

Omakase is a marathon, not a sprint. Sip your drink. Let each course land before the next arrives. This slow progression is part of what makes the experience special.

Avoid filling up on liquids early. Save room for the story.

What Makes Omakase Worth It

Omakase is not just a meal. It is trust, timing, and intention on a plate. When done well, it feels personal. You are not one of many orders. You are the guest for whom the evening is being created.

From my side of the counter, the most memorable guests are not the ones who know the most about food. They are the ones who simply show up curious and open, and leave feeling cared for.

That is the heart of omakase.

The North: A Symphony of Rich Flavors

The northern regions of Italy, with their cooler climate and mountainous landscapes, present a culinary style that is rich, hearty, and comforting. Exploring Italy’s culinary heartlands in the north introduces food lovers to a blend of French, German, and Austrian influences. Lombardia, Veneto, and Piedmont are known for their luxurious dishes, often featuring butter, rich cheeses, and meats.

In Lombardia, the famous risotto alla Milanese, made with saffron, is a must-try. This dish, as vibrant as the region itself, highlights the Italian penchant for transforming simple ingredients into something extraordinary. Meanwhile, in Piedmont, the cuisine revolves around rich, earthy flavors such as the renowned agnolotti pasta stuffed with meat, paired with a glass of Barolo, one of the region’s famous wines. This is a true example of Italian sophistication at its finest.

The region of Emilia-Romagna, often regarded as the birthplace of Italian food culture, is another northern gem. Known for its iconic Parmigiano Reggiano cheese, balsamic vinegar from Modena, and rich pasta dishes like tagliatelle al ragù (better known outside Italy as Bolognese), Emilia-Romagna is a regional Italian food tour that will leave you yearning for more. These ingredients are not just staples but a way of life, with each product carrying centuries of history and craftsmanship.

Central Italy: The Heart of Italian Flavors

As you move south, the landscapes change, and so do the flavors. Central Italy, particularly Tuscany and Umbria, is home to rustic, robust dishes that focus on the best local ingredients. A food journey across Italy is incomplete without a visit to this region, where the culinary philosophy is all about simplicity, quality, and seasonality.

Tuscany is perhaps best known for its exceptional olive oil, which is central to nearly every dish. The Tuscan bread, unsalted and hearty, is perfect for mopping up rich sauces or served with ribollita, a vegetable and bread soup that’s a staple of the region. In Umbria, the famed truffle is a must-try, gracing everything from pasta to pizzas. The region’s porchetta, a slow-roasted pork dish, is another example of how central Italy transforms simple, local ingredients into extraordinary meals.

The rolling hills of Marche add yet another dimension to central Italy’s food scene, where fresh seafood, wild mushrooms, and regional wines like Verdicchio reign supreme. The Marche region offers a more understated, yet no less delightful, food experience, with lesser-known but equally exquisite dishes that reflect the unpretentious elegance of the region.

Southern Italy: Sun-Soaked Flavors and Bold Tastes

Southern Italy is where the cuisine truly sings with vibrant, bold flavors. Here, the sun-drenched landscapes produce rich tomatoes, olives, and citrus fruits, all of which play a starring role in the region’s cooking. Italy’s best food regions are beautifully represented in the south, where the food is characterized by its intensity, spice, and robust flavors.

In Campania, the region surrounding Naples, pizza reigns supreme. The traditional Margherita pizza, with its perfect balance of fresh mozzarella, tomatoes, and basil, embodies the essence of Italian cuisine—simple yet full of flavor. Another Campanian specialty is the delicate mozzarella di bufala, a creamy cheese that will leave you enchanted with its fresh, milky taste.

Sicily, at the very tip of Italy, offers a unique fusion of Greek, Arab, and Spanish influences that make its food distinct from any other region. Exploring Italy’s culinary heartlands in Sicily means savoring dishes like arancini (fried rice balls stuffed with ragù or cheese), caponata (eggplant and vegetable stew), and cannoli (crispy pastry filled with ricotta cheese). Sicilian food is a vibrant celebration of history and culture, where each dish is a testament to the island’s diverse heritage.

In Puglia, the food takes on a simpler, Mediterranean flair. Known for its orecchiette pasta, Puglia’s cuisine highlights fresh vegetables, seafood, and the ever-present olive oil. The region’s focus on local ingredients results in dishes that are light, flavorful, and incredibly satisfying.

The Islands: A Fusion of Traditions and Flavors

No discussion of Italy’s best food regions would be complete without mentioning its islands. Sardinia, often overshadowed by its larger neighbor Sicily, offers a culinary experience that’s both unique and deeply rooted in tradition. Sardinian cuisine is characterized by a mix of land and sea ingredients, with dishes like suckling pig (porceddu) and fregola pasta with seafood providing a glimpse into the island’s rustic charm. The use of local herbs, cheeses, and honey gives Sardinian food an undeniable authenticity.

Both Sicily and Sardinia celebrate the island’s natural bounty, from fresh seafood to wild herbs, and their dishes carry a deep sense of place. A regional Italian food tour that includes these islands unveils an entirely new dimension of Italy’s culinary story.

1. Master the Art of Searing

Searing is a basic technique that can make a world of difference when cooking meats, vegetables, or even tofu. This method involves cooking food at a high temperature to create a beautifully browned, flavorful crust. The easy ways to enhance flavor through searing are endless, and it’s a skill that top chefs use to build rich, complex flavors in their dishes.

Tip: Ensure your pan is preheated before adding the food. If it’s not hot enough, the food will just stick and won’t achieve that signature crispy golden exterior. Don’t overcrowd the pan; give each piece room to brown properly.

Whether it’s a steak, chicken breast, or even vegetables like mushrooms, the result will be a caramelized crust that locks in moisture and enhances the overall taste.

2. Use the Power of Seasoning

The key to elevating your cooking lies in understanding how to season your food properly. Seasoning isn’t just about adding salt at the end—simple cooking methods involve seasoning at various stages throughout the cooking process. Salt enhances the natural flavors of food, while herbs and spices bring vibrancy to your dishes.

Tip: Start by seasoning your ingredients before cooking and taste as you go. Add salt to your meats before searing them, and season sauces or stews as they cook. Herbs like thyme, rosemary, and bay leaves infuse flavor as they cook, so be sure to add them early on. At the end, taste again and adjust for balance with a dash of pepper, a squeeze of citrus, or even a splash of vinegar.

By layering your seasonings, you’ll achieve a deeper, more complex flavor profile.

3. Embrace the Simplicity of Roasting

Roasting is a simple but highly effective technique that can bring out the best in many ingredients. When you roast vegetables, meats, or even fruits, the heat causes the natural sugars to caramelize, creating a depth of flavor that is rich and satisfying. Roasting is one of the most easy ways to enhance flavor while requiring minimal effort.

Tip: Preheat your oven before placing your ingredients inside, and don’t overcrowd the pan. This will allow the food to roast evenly and get that perfect caramelized texture. For vegetables, toss them with olive oil, salt, and pepper, and roast until golden and tender. Roasting vegetables like carrots, sweet potatoes, or Brussels sprouts brings out their natural sweetness and makes them irresistible.

For meats, a high-heat roast followed by a lower temperature allows the meat to develop a rich crust on the outside while keeping it juicy on the inside.

4. Don’t Forget About Resting Meat

It may seem counterintuitive, but one of the most overlooked simple cooking methods is letting meat rest after cooking. Whether you’re cooking a roast, steak, or chicken, allowing the meat to rest before cutting into it ensures that the juices redistribute evenly, resulting in a tender, flavorful piece of meat.

Tip: Once your meat is cooked, cover it loosely with foil and let it rest for 5 to 10 minutes. This technique is especially important for larger cuts of meat, like roasts or whole chickens, but it applies to smaller pieces like steaks as well. The result is a juicier, more flavorful dish that’s well worth the wait.

5. Build Layers of Flavor with Sautéing

Sautéing is a quick and effective technique that involves cooking food in a small amount of fat over high heat. It’s ideal for vegetables, garlic, onions, and proteins like shrimp or chicken. The high heat allows food to cook quickly while developing deep, savory flavors through browning and caramelization. It’s one of the best techniques for better meals, especially when you want to highlight the natural flavors of ingredients without overpowering them.

Tip: Always preheat your pan before adding the fat, whether it’s oil, butter, or ghee. Use enough fat to coat the bottom of the pan, but don’t drown the food in it. Make sure to stir frequently to avoid burning and ensure even cooking.

By sautéing your vegetables with garlic or shallots, for example, you create a base that can be the foundation for a wide variety of dishes, from stir-fries to soups.

6. The Magic of Simmering

Simmering is a cooking technique that involves cooking food in liquid at a low temperature, just below boiling point. It’s ideal for making soups, stews, sauces, and braises. This method allows flavors to meld together over time, creating hearty, flavorful dishes with little effort.

Tip: Start by bringing the liquid to a boil, then reduce the heat so it’s just below the boiling point, where gentle bubbles form. The long, slow cooking process allows the ingredients to release their flavors, resulting in a richer and more complex dish. This method is perfect for tougher cuts of meat, which become incredibly tender when simmered for a few hours.

For an extra burst of flavor, consider adding a bouquet garni or a bay leaf to the simmering liquid to infuse it with aromatic flavors.

7. Add Fresh Herbs at the Right Time

Fresh herbs are a game-changer in cooking. However, when and how you add them can make all the difference. Adding them too early can cause them to lose their freshness and vibrancy, while adding them too late may not allow them to infuse their full flavor. Understanding when to add fresh herbs is key to elevating your cooking.

Tip: Add delicate herbs like basil, parsley, or cilantro at the end of cooking to preserve their fresh flavor and color. Hardier herbs like thyme, rosemary, and sage can go in earlier, as they can withstand the heat and infuse their flavors into the dish.

The right touch of fresh herbs can brighten up any dish, from pasta and salads to meats and sauces.

The Foundations of Italian Cooking

Italian cuisine is built on a foundation of fresh, high-quality ingredients. From the olive oils of Tuscany to the cheeses of Piedmont, each region contributes its own unique products to the rich tapestry of Italy’s food culture. Central to mastering Italian cuisine is understanding that the simplest of ingredients are often the most flavorful. Fresh tomatoes, basil, garlic, and seasonal vegetables are used in abundance, often in their purest form. This dedication to quality over quantity is key to the authenticity of Italian dishes.

Italian Cooking Techniques: Less is More

One of the most striking features of Italian cooking techniques is their reliance on simplicity. The goal is to highlight the natural flavors of the ingredients, not overshadow them with excessive seasoning or complicated preparation. For example, when making pasta, Italians do not overcomplicate the process. The dough is made from a combination of flour, eggs, and sometimes water—nothing more. The pasta is then shaped by hand or machine, and cooked al dente, creating a satisfying texture that complements a variety of sauces.

In the kitchen, timing and temperature control are paramount. A well-made ragu, a rich, slow-cooked meat sauce, is a masterpiece of patience. Similarly, an expertly prepared risotto involves slow stirring and gradual addition of stock to achieve that creamy, tender consistency that characterizes the dish. The concept of cooking Italian food at home revolves around finding joy in the process, understanding when to intervene and when to let the ingredients shine on their own.

The Role of Olive Oil and Herbs

In Food Italy cooking style, olive oil is more than just a cooking fat—it is a key flavoring agent. Italians use it liberally in almost every dish, whether drizzling it over fresh salads or sautéing vegetables for a hearty sauce. The oil’s quality is crucial, as it serves as the base for many dishes. Extra virgin olive oil, cold-pressed and rich in flavor, is preferred for its fruity, slightly peppery taste.

Herbs, too, play an integral role in Italian cooking. Basil, oregano, rosemary, and thyme are just a few of the fragrant herbs that elevate Italian dishes. A fresh pesto made with basil, garlic, pine nuts, Parmesan, and olive oil is a prime example of how herbs can transform a dish into something extraordinary. The balance of freshness, warmth, and subtle earthiness is a signature of Italian cooking that comes from the art of seasoning with precision.
